- The distance between Uzgorod, Ukraine and Surat Thani, Thailand is approximately 8,284 km or 5,148 mi.
- To reach Uzgorod in this distance one would set out from Surat Thani bearing 318.1°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Uzgorod bearing 273.8° or W .
- Uzgorod has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Surat Thani has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
- Uzgorod is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Surat Thani is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 16.8 °C (30.2°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 19.8 °C (35.6°F) more in Uzgorod.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to extremely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 896 mm (35.3 in) less which is equivalent to 896 l/m² (21.99 US gal/ft²) or 8,960,000 l/ha (957,883 US gal/ac) less. About 4/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 32.4° lower in Uzgorod than in Surat Thani.
